What Are the Main Benefits of Extended Time at Home?

Many people report positive effects from periods of reduced movement and increased home focus. They may complete personal projects, develop new skills, or simply enjoy quieter daily rhythms. Lockdown: The Highs and Lows of House Arrest often highlights how reduced external noise can create space for reflection and intentional habit building. Financial savings from fewer outings and transportation costs can also provide a sense of relief. When structured thoughtfully, these stretches of time at home can feel restorative rather than restrictive.

How Does This Experience Impact Mental Health?

Isolation and monotony are common themes within Lockdown: The Highs and Lows of House Arrest, especially when days lack variety or social contact. Some individuals feel lonely or disconnected, while others struggle with anxiety about health or professional stability. Maintaining a routine, staying in touch with friends virtually, and setting clear work boundaries can help mitigate these challenges. Recognizing early signs of emotional strain allows people to seek support before these feelings become overwhelming.

Things People Often Misunderstand

A common myth is that extended time at home automatically leads to greater happiness or productivity for everyone. In reality, Lockdown: The Highs and Lows of House Arrest shows a wide spectrum of outcomes, influenced by personality, resources, and support systems. Some people thrive with structure and solitude, while others need regular external stimulation to feel engaged. Another misunderstanding is that all home-based periods are voluntary, when in fact many people experience these conditions due to circumstances beyond their control.

It is also easy to assume that social connections suffer permanently after a long home-based period. While some relationships may fade, others deepen through more intentional communication and shared experiences.
